The Supply Chain Advisor leads moderately to highly complex projects to onboard suppliers and implement enhancements into SCE’s SAP Ariba and Fieldglass platforms. The Advisor collaborates with Operating Units (OU’s), Supply Management, Information Technology, and third-party vendors to develop strategies, identify operational requirements, design new processes, communicate with suppliers, and coordinates ongoing transactions and relationships. The Advisor also works within their team and the IT department to identify and problem-solve system issues in relation to procurement transactions and convey results and solutions to key stakeholders or end users.
